Introduction to Cephalexin 500 Mg

Cephalexin 500 mg capsules are a type of antibiotic that belongs to the cephalosporin family, which is used to treat a wide range of bacterial infections. Its effectiveness stems from its ability to inhibit bacterial cell wall synthesis, ultimately leading to the elimination of the bacteria. Learn more about Cephalexin.

How Cephalexin 500 Mg Works

Understanding the action of Cephalexin is crucial. This antibiotic interferes with the formation of the bacterial cell wall, a critical component for bacterial survival and replication. By weakening the cell wall, it causes the bacteria to rupture and die, effectively tackling the infection.

Common Uses of Cephalexin 500 Mg

Cephalexin is an effective treatment for various infections. Below are the most common types of infections for which Cephalexin is prescribed:

Respiratory Tract Infections

  • Common Conditions: It treats conditions such as bronchitis and pneumonia.
  • Action: The antibiotic targets the bacteria causing the infection, reducing symptoms like cough and breathlessness.

Skin Infections

  • Types of Infections: Useful against cellulitis, boils, and abscesses.
  • Advantages: Helps in reducing redness, swelling, and pain associated with skin infections.

Ear Infections

  • Specifics: Addresses middle ear infections, also known as otitis media.
  • Outcome: Relieves ear pain and discomfort by eradicating the bacteria causing the infection.

Dosage and Administration

Taking Cephalexin the right way is essential. Here’s a quick guide:

  • Typical Dosage: Generally prescribed at 250 mg to 500 mg every 6 hours, depending on the severity of the infection.
  • Instructions: Always follow the prescription label and consult your healthcare provider before making any changes.

Potential Side Effects

Awareness of side effects is critical for safe medication use. While many patients tolerate Cephalexin well, some may experience side effects:

  • Common Side Effects: Include nausea, diarrhea, and dizziness.
  • Severe Reactions: Immediate medical attention is required for symptoms like allergic reactions or difficulty breathing.

Drug Interactions and Precautions

Being informed of drug interactions is vital to avoid adverse effects:

  • Common Interactions: Warfarin and Metformin may interact with Cephalexin.
  • Precautions: Ensure to inform your healthcare provider about any other medications you are taking.

FAQs

  1. Can Cephalexin be used for viral infections?
    • No, Cephalexin is only effective against bacterial infections, not viral infections like the flu or cold.
  2. Is it safe to consume alcohol while taking Cephalexin 500 Mg?
    • It’s advisable to avoid alcohol as it may increase certain side effects like drowsiness and dizziness.
  3. How long does it typically take for Cephalexin to work?
    • Improvement can usually be seen within a few days, but it’s crucial to complete the full course of medication.
  4. What happens if a dose is missed?
    • Take the missed dose as soon as you remember unless it’s close to the next scheduled dose. Do not double up doses.
  5. Are there any foods I should avoid while taking Cephalexin?
    • There are no specific foods to avoid, but maintaining a balanced diet is recommended for optimal recovery.
